What is the Washington Trade Act Determination Form?
The Washington Trade Act Determination Form is essential for workers in Washington State seeking Trade Readjustment Allowance (TRA) benefits. This form simplifies the application process for individuals affected by trade-related job losses, ensuring they receive critical financial assistance under the Trade Act of 1974. By linking workers with support services, it plays a crucial role in safeguarding employment security.

Who Needs to Complete the Washington Trade Act Determination Form?
The primary audience for completing this form includes former employees whose jobs were impacted by trade factors such as foreign competition. Specific categories of workers, including those laid off or facing reduced hours due to international trade, may qualify for these benefits. Eligibility is determined based on criteria that assess the nature of employment disruption and the worker's prior job status.
Eligibility Criteria for the Washington Trade Act Determination Form
To qualify for TRA benefits, applicants must meet specific eligibility requirements. Key factors influencing qualification include the duration of prior employment, reasons for unemployment, and accurate documentation substantiating their claims. Collecting necessary evidence, such as termination letters and pay stubs, is critical for a successful application.

Who is eligible to fill out the Washington Trade Act Determination Form?
Workers in Washington State who are facing unemployment or reduced hours due to international trade agreements may apply for Trade Readjustment Allowance (TRA) benefits through this form.
